What are Dental Implants?

Dental implants are titanium posts. These implants are placed into the jawbone under the gum line. These biocompatible metal anchors serve as artificial tooth roots, providing a sturdy foundation for mounting replacement teeth. The implant fuses with the jawbone. It creates a stable base that prevents bone loss and maintains facial structure. This process is called osseointegration.

A complete dental implant restoration mainly includes three parts:

  • The implant: The titanium post that integrates with the jawbone
  • The abutment: A connector which attaches to the implant and supports the crown
  • The crown: The visible portion that resembles a natural tooth

Benefits of Choosing Dental Implants

Dental implants provide many benefits compared to traditional options:

Durability and Longevity

Given proper care, dental implants may last for decades or even a lifetime. Unlike dental implants, dentures or bridges may need to be replaced every 5-10 years. However, implants provide a permanent solution to tooth loss.

Natural Appearance and Function

Dental implants function like natural teeth. The crown portion is custom-designed to match your existing teeth in shape and color, creating a seamless smile. You can confidently speak, eat, and smile, knowing your restoration will remain secure.

Preservation of Bone Structure

When a tooth is lost, the jawbone in the empty space deteriorates over time. Dental implants stimulate bone growth just as natural tooth roots. They help prevent bone loss besides maintaining facial structure.

Protection of Adjacent Teeth

Unlike traditional bridges that require grinding down neighboring teeth for support, dental implants stand independently, preserving the integrity of adjacent healthy teeth.

Improved Oral Health

Dental implants are much easier to clean compared to bridges or dentures, promoting better oral hygiene. They also eliminate the need for adhesives and the inconvenience of removable appliances.

The Dental Implant Procedure

The process of dental implants generally involves several steps and takes place over a few months:

Initial Consultation and Planning

Your journey will begin with a comprehensive evaluation, including 3D imaging, for assessing bone density and determining the optimal placement of implants. A customized treatment plan is then developed according to your specific needs.

Implant Placement

Healing Period

After placement, the healing period takes 3-6 months, which allows the implant to integrate with the surrounding bone. A temporary restoration may be placed during this time in some cases.

Abutment Placement

Once osseointegration is complete, a small connector post (abutment) is attached to the implant, extending just above the gumline.

Crown Placement

Finally, a custom-crafted crown is secured to the abutment, completing your restoration with a natural-looking replacement tooth.

Candidates for Dental Implants

Most adults having good general and oral health are candidates for dental implants. Ideal candidates have:

  • Healthy gum tissue free from periodontal disease
  • Adequate bone density to support the implant
  • Good oral hygiene habits
  • No uncontrolled chronic conditions that affect healing

Even patients having experienced bone loss may still be eligible for implants with additional procedures like bone grafting or sinus lifts.

Types of Dental Implant Restorations

Dental implants can help with various types of restorations:

  • Single-tooth replacement: One implant with one crown
  • Multiple-tooth replacement: Implant-supported bridges for several missing teeth
  • Full-arch replacement: All-on-4 or All-on-6 techniques that use four to six implants
  • Implant-retained dentures: Removable dentures that snap onto implants for improved stability
